Mad Lib Me Python: 10 hapa
Mad Lib Me Python: 10 hapa
Anonim
Lib i çmendur me Python
Lib i çmendur me Python

Bërja e një programi të Mad Libs në python

Çfarë ju nevojitet:

1. Kompjuter Windows ose Mac

2. Lidhje me internetin

Çfarë do të dini deri në fund:

1. Vargje

2. Ndryshoret

2. Funksionet e hyrjes dhe printimit

Hapi 1: Shkarkoni Python

Shkarkoni Python
Shkarkoni Python

Së pari ju duhet të shkarkoni python (padyshim). Shkoni te python.org, klikoni butonin e shkarkimit dhe zgjidhni versionin e duhur për sistemin tuaj.

Hapi 2: Hapni IDLE

Hap IDLE
Hap IDLE

Pasi të keni shkarkuar dhe instaluar Python, hapni IDLE. IDLE është mjedisi i programimit që ne do të përdorim për këtë tutorial. Ka disa programe të tjera në të cilat mund të shkruajmë python, por ky është programi bazë i paketuar me vetë Python.

Hapi 3: Rrëmujë pak

Rrëmujë Rreth Pak
Rrëmujë Rreth Pak

Dritarja që shfaqet kur hapni IDLE për herë të parë mund të përdoret si një lloj sheshi lojrash për kodin Python. Kur shtypni një komandë dhe godisni enter, ajo automatikisht drejton atë linjë dhe ruan çdo vlerë të caktuar në kujtesë. Vazhdoni dhe përsëritni kodin tim, ndoshta me emrin tuaj dhe disa emra të ndryshëm, për të marrë një ide bazë se si funksionon gjithçka. Mos u shqetësoni nëse nuk e kuptoni, ne do të shkojmë më thellë në hapat e mëposhtëm.

Hapi 4: Krijoni Skedarin Aktual të Programit

Krijoni Skedarin Aktual të Programit
Krijoni Skedarin Aktual të Programit

Shkrimi i kodit në shesh lojërash është argëtues, por për të ruajtur një program me aftësinë për ta ekzekutuar vetë, ne duhet të ruajmë kodin në një skedar programi. Krijoni një skedar të ri për të shkruar programin.

Hapi 5: Para se të fillojmë të shkruajmë Kodin

Para se të fillojmë të shkruajmë Kodin
Para se të fillojmë të shkruajmë Kodin

Në mënyrë që të marrim informacion nga përdoruesi dhe ta ruajmë atë, duhet të krijojmë ndryshore për secilën nga fjalët që duam të ruajmë. Mendoni për një ndryshore siç do ta përdorni në Algjebër. Ju e emërtoni ndryshoren në anën e majtë dhe më pas e caktoni atë në një vlerë duke përdorur shenjën e barabartë. Ndryshe nga Algjebra, ju mund të ruani më shumë se vetëm numra në variabla. Në rastin e këtij programi ne do të ruajmë vargje. Një varg është vetëm një fjalë ose fjali. Vini re se çdo herë që përdoret teksti është i rrethuar me thonjëza ''. Mund të përdorni thonjëza të vetme ose të dyfishta për sa kohë që hapja është e njëjtë me atë mbyllëse. Këto citate nuk janë të nevojshme për numrat ose ndryshoret, vetëm për vargjet.

Hapi 6: Filloni të shkruani programin tuaj

Filloni të shkruani programin tuaj
Filloni të shkruani programin tuaj

Për të filluar, le të bëjmë një ndryshore për secilën prej katër fjalëve që duhet të marrim nga përdoruesi. Për të marrë të dhëna nga përdoruesi ne përdorim input (). Duke vendosur vlerën e secilës ndryshore në input () ne mund të marrim input nga përdoruesi dhe t'i ruajmë në ato ndryshore.

Për të printuar tekstin tek përdoruesi ne përdorim komandën print () dhe vendosim gjithçka që duhet të printohet në kllapa. Mos harroni se vargjet duhet të rrethohen me thonjëza '', por jo me emra variablash. Shtypni fjalët rresht duke përsëritur kodin në funksionin tim të printimit.

Hapi 7: Drejtoni programin

Drejtoni Programin
Drejtoni Programin

Tani që kemi një program funksional, vazhdoni dhe ekzekutoni atë duke klikuar modulin drejtuar dhe ekzekutuar. Nëse nuk e keni ruajtur skedarin, do t'ju kërkojë ta ruani skedarin para se ta ekzekutoni. Bëni kështu, pastaj lini programin të funksionojë. Ju do të vini re se asgjë nuk printohet, kjo ndodh sepse ne i kemi kërkuar përdoruesit vetëm të dhëna, në fakt nuk i kemi nxitur me ndonjë pyetje. Vazhdoni dhe shtypni 4 fjalë duke goditur, futini mes tyre për t'i futur ato dhe më pas sigurohuni që fjalët të shtypen saktë. Nëse e bëjnë këtë, kthehuni te skedari i programit dhe kaloni në hapin tjetër.

Hapi 8: Shtimi i Nxitjeve në Vlerat Input

Shtimi i Nxitjeve në Vlerat Input
Shtimi i Nxitjeve në Vlerat Input

Në mënyrë që funksioni input () të ketë një kërkesë, ne vendosim një varg të asaj që duam të printohet në mes të kllapës. Vazhdoni dhe shtoni një kërkesë për secilën prej hyrjeve dhe më pas drejtoni programin për t'u siguruar që ata po punojnë si duhet. Ju do të vini re se në timen kam vënë një hapësirë pas: para mbylljes me kuotën. Kjo është kështu që kur përdoruesi të shtypë, nuk do të copëtohet pranë zorrës së trashë.

Hapi 9: Krijoni daljen

Krijo Output
Krijo Output

Meqenëse po shtojmë printimin aktual, vazhdoni dhe hiqni qafe funksionin e printimit testues që kemi shtuar më herët. Tani, për të nxjerrë librin e çmendur saktë, ka disa gjëra që duhet të dini. Së pari, meqenëse ne po shtypim një poezi dhe duam që ajo të përfshijë rreshta të shumtë, është e rëndësishme të theksohet se shtypja '\ n' në një varg do të kalojë në rreshtin tjetër. Së dyti, kur shtypni një varg mund të përdorni mbajtëset kaçurrelë {} dhe.format () për të futur tekst në varg. Për shembull 'Më pëlqen {0} dhe {1}'. Formati ('ushqim', 'ujë') do të printojë 'Më pëlqen ushqimi dhe uji'. Ne mund ta përdorim këtë në avantazhin tonë kur shtypim librat e çmendur. Kopjoni kodin në figurë në programin tuaj.

Hapi 10: Drejtoni programin edhe një herë

Vazhdoni dhe ekzekutoni programin edhe një herë për të siguruar që ai po funksionon si duhet. Urime! Ju sapo keni shkruar programin tuaj të parë Python.

Recommended: